Internalization
The process of integrating beliefs, values, standards, or norms into one's own cognitive structure, often influencing behavior.
Identification
Refers to the process by which individuals associate themselves with particular groups, causing those groups' values and norms to become integrated into their own self-concept.
Socialization
The process by which individuals learn and adopt the values, behaviors, and norms of a society or group.
Attitudes
An individual's settled way of thinking or feeling about someone or something, typically reflected in their behavior.
